Crime Snapshot – Coronado’s Security Landscape
Although Coronado is affluent, its crime rates are higher than the California and U.S. average—especially noticeable due to smaller population size.
Total Crime Rate: ≈24.4 crimes per 1,000 residents (1 in 41 chance) neighborhoodscout.com
Violent Crime: 3.25 per 1,000 (1 in 307 chance)—mostly assaults and robberies.
Property Crime: 21.15 per 1,000 (1 in 47 chance), with notable rates of vehicle theft (1 in 219).
Motor Vehicle Theft: Especially high at ~4.56 per 1,000 residents neighborhoodscout.com+1sfchronicle.com+1
Crime Escalation:
Violent crime has increased sharply year-over-year, as total crimes surged ~93%, violent crimes +331%, and property crimes +77% in recent data .
